Hope is the thing with feathers...

 
 
 

...that perches in the soul, and sings the tune without words, and never stops at all. (Emily Dickinson)

This image was inspired by the Godess Ma'at (see here) as she is described in Tad Williams' Otherland series.

'The dead person's heart was placed on a scale, balanced by the feather of Ma'at.'

Normally Ma'at is represented by an ostrich feather, however, in this case I've used crow feathers as they worked better with my overall image - note the small hieroglyph in the bottom right-hand corner.

Svaha - Photo Manipulation

 
 
This is the illustration to my poem. Both were inspired by a Charles de Lint novel of the same name. In the novel 'Svaha' = (SVA-ha) means the time between when you see the lightning and when you hear the thunder - (Native American, tribe unknown).

Although a little research showed that this may be a myth and that the name is actually of Indian origin and is used as a mantra or the name of a goddess or both...

However, to accomodate both ideas (although I prefer the first one) I added both to the poem and image.

The novel is pretty good, and I just love the idea of that moment when you see the lighting and wait for the roar of the thunder. A pretty special moment as far as I am concerned.... :-)
